About Los Angeles

Los Angeles has 336 schools. One of the highest rated schools is Alfred B. Nobel Charter Middle School, which is rated 9. The school has 2,288 students. The public schools in Los Angeles are in Los Angeles Unified. Beverly Hills Unified School District is close by and rates better than Los Angeles Unified. Nearby Burbank Unified is better, with a rating of 7. Los Angeles's population is 3,799,129. Los Angeles Unified enrolls 18% of the population of Los Angeles.
